The story behind the hand three and a half of Indonesian volleyball stars at SEA Games 32

Appearing on the opening day of the 32nd SEA Games Men's Volleyball, the famous star of the Indonesian volleyball team, Fahan Halim, made many people pay attention to his hand with only his three and a half fingers.

Every time this young man was born in 2001, he jumped onto the ball, his special hand attracted the attention of both the media and the viewer to play directly.

This 1.93m high young owner is currently the pillar and the leading star of Southeast Asia Southeast Asia Volleyball, so his speciality has received a lot of attention. Behind the special hand is a touching story.

Farhan Halim's hand lost 1.5 fingers in grade 4, Halim unfortunately trapped the right elbow at the lake's rack at the school, the little finger was the heaviest and it was the ring finger.

When taken to the hospital, the doctor said surgery. There are two cases, one is to connect the tendon of the little finger and the youngest, but the recovery rate is only about 50% and the cost is up to 114 million RP at that time.

Finally, he chose to cut the little finger and half of his ring finger. Losing your fingers with ordinary people has made life difficult, with a volleyball athlete that is even more difficult.

The 10X owner must make many times more efforts to write the ancient story, not only overcome fate but also become the star of the Southeast Asian Men's volleyball team.

Sharing in the press, Farhan Halim once said that his hand especially made him fall into a difficult situation, especially when blocking the ball. Many times he was lost or the opponent “fluttered” failed.

At the 32nd SEA Games, Farhan Halim's story becomes more and more special and becomes a story that inspires many people.
